How does cross-chain interoperability affect Vietnam’s financial future?

Cross-chain interoperability acts as a currency exchange booth for blockchains; it allows different platforms to communicate and operate seamlessly. In Vietnam, this could foster more inclusive financial services and attract foreign investments. Without this interoperability, transactions and smart contracts remain isolated, limiting their potential benefits.

What role do zero-knowledge proofs play in enhancing privacy?

Think of zero-knowledge proofs like a password: you can prove you have it without revealing it. This technology is pivotal in protecting user privacy within the expanding realm of Smart cities Vietnam AI. Users will demand transparent transactions without sacrificing personal information, much like how a shopper prefers to pay in cash to keep their spending habits private.
